I can confidently say that 'It Ends with Us' is the perfect starting point. This novel is a masterclass in emotional storytelling, blending raw heartbreak with moments of profound hope. The characters feel incredibly real, and the way Hoover tackles difficult themes like domestic violence is both sensitive and unflinching.

If you enjoy that, 'Verity' is a fantastic follow-up—it’s a gripping psychological thriller with a romantic undercurrent that will leave you questioning everything. For a lighter but equally impactful read, 'Ugly Love' delivers a steamy, angsty romance that’s impossible to put down. Each of these books showcases Hoover’s versatility, making her one of the most compelling authors in contemporary fiction.

For those diving into Colleen Hoover’s world, 'November 9' is a standout. The premise—two people meeting on the same date every year—is unique, and the emotional rollercoaster it takes you on is unforgettable. The protagonist’s journey of self-discovery and the twist halfway through will leave you speechless. Another solid pick is 'Hopeless', which dives into darker themes but with Hoover’s signature warmth and hope shining through. Her books are like a cozy blanket and a punch to the gut at the same time.

If you’re new to Colleen Hoover, start with 'All Your Perfects'. It’s a raw, honest portrayal of marriage and infertility, with a love story that feels achingly real. The alternating timelines between past and present add depth, and the emotional payoff is worth every tear. For something shorter but equally powerful, 'Confess' is a gem—it blends art and romance in a way only Hoover can. Her books are perfect for readers who crave stories with heart and grit.

I’ve been recommending Colleen Hoover to friends for years, and my go-to pick for newcomers is always 'Slammed'. It’s a beautiful mix of poetry and romance, with a storyline that’s both tender and intense. The chemistry between the main characters is electric, and the way Hoover weaves in themes of grief and resilience is downright masterful. If you’re looking for something with a bit more edge, 'Maybe Someday' is a great choice—it’s got music, betrayal, and a love triangle that’ll keep you hooked. Hoover’s ability to balance emotion with page-turning drama is what makes her books so addictive.

Tough call, because honestly you can jump in almost anywhere and get a different flavor of her work. I've seen a lot of people point to 'It Ends with Us' as the entry point nowadays, which makes sense because it's the one with all the buzz. That heavy, real-world emotional gut-punch is her signature for a reason. But my personal take? I started with 'Slammed' years ago, the one with the poetry slams and the young adult vibe. It's a lot lighter than her recent stuff, more first-love awkwardness and family drama than the intense trauma narratives she's known for now. It gives you the foundation of her writing—those big feelings, the romance—without the heaviness of her later books. 'Ugly Love' is another popular starter; it's got that classic New Adult angst and a romance that burns hot and fast. If you're going for what defines her current reputation, go with 'It Ends with Us.' If you want the full evolution, maybe start at the beginning with 'Slammed' and see how her voice changed. No wrong answers, really. One thing I'll note: her books are super addictive once you get the rhythm. I blew through three in a weekend once. Just be ready for that. The scene where Lily writes her childhood diary entries to Ellen DeGeneres in 'It Ends with Us' is such a specific, effective device. It gives her teenage voice a clear, honest channel and provides heartbreaking dramatic irony for the adult reader. It’s a great example of Hoover’s knack for using simple, relatable framing devices to deepen character. Across her books, she often uses these little structural tricks—dual timelines, found manuscripts, annual meetings, artistic collaboration. If you appreciate clever narrative mechanics within an emotional story, 'November 9' or 'Confess' might be your best entry point.

in what order should i read colleen hoover books

4 Answers2025-08-01 09:43:47
I’d suggest starting with 'Slammed' and 'Point of Retreat' if you want to experience her early writing style—raw, emotional, and full of poetic undertones. These two books set the tone for her signature blend of heartache and hope. Then, move to 'Hopeless' and 'Losing Hope,' which dive deeper into trauma and healing. 'It Ends with Us' and 'It Starts with Us' should come next because they tackle heavier themes with incredible sensitivity. After that, 'Ugly Love' and 'Confess' offer gripping, character-driven stories with unique narrative structures. For something lighter but still impactful, 'Maybe Someday' and its companion novels are perfect. End with 'Verity' if you want a thrilling departure from her usual romance—it’s dark, twisty, and unforgettable. Reading them this way lets you appreciate her growth as a writer while emotionally preparing you for the heavier reads.
